We are thrilled to announce that we have secured planning approval for Phase 1B of our Harbour Village scheme, a development of 121 homes in Ebbsfleet Garden City for Bellway.

Part of a residential-led masterplan delivering 532 homes in the area, Phase 1B will provide a range of mixed-tenure homes designed for families, couples and first-time buyers. Working in collaboration with landscape architects LUC, the proposals are based around the new Chimney View Park which is being brought forward as part of the planning application and has been designed following a local children’s competition, creating play facilities for younger residents as well as a space for social interaction for both existing and new communities. As such, the architecture across the scheme seeks to create a formal backdrop to the park whilst also referencing the local area in its materiality. The result is a development which will build a diverse community and offer opportunities for play, all whilst blending seamlessly with the surrounding context.

Alongside the creation of new homes and Chimney View Park, significant ecological enhancements are being made to the site with a proposed planting palette containing a diverse range of species, rich grasslands which will enhance biodiversity value and over 25 different tree types being planted across the scheme.
